If you would have read more on that thread you would have known that it's better to use 550/200 instead of 150/225 however for your question, your bios will only allow you to go as low as 1.237 and if you use the enable superior powerplay in RBE, it will lower it to 1.083 and your maximum will only be 1.263 and at the clocks you are using the card won't probably be stable.

I suggest you continue reading to find what suits you best and to take a look at the 3 modded bioses attached to my signature, you might find what you are looking for.
